8482042030 for TOYOTA RAV4 1997-2000 New Window Control Switch Power Window Master Switch 84820-42030

8482042030 for TOYOTA RAV4 1997-2000 New Window Control Switch Power Window Master Switch 84820-42030
thumb
thumb
sku: 1005001457812886
$22.17
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ed